Do this to reregister the Jscript.dll and Vbscript.dll files.

Start - type in the search box - find command top - RIGHT CLICK – RUN AS ADMIN

type or copy and paste-> regsvr32 jscript.dll
Press enter

type or copy and paste-> regsvr32 vbscript.dll
Press enter

Restart and if all goes well, it will run now.

    The Player downloads album art to a database online where the information is provided by a variety of non-Microsoft, as AMG data providers.

    The Player downloads album art when you rip a CD. To do this, the Player tries to match the CD for an entry in the online database. If it finds a match, the Player automatically downloads the media information that is available for the CD, including album art. In addition, the reader travels periodically your library songs lacking album art. If it can match a song that is missing from the album art to an entry in the database online, the player will download the missing album art. For information about changing how the Player downloads album art and other media information, see the question bring the player to the difficulty of the media information automatically in media information: frequently asked questions.

    Why is album art missing sometimes?

    The player would not be able to download album art from the database in the following situations:

    • You are not connected to the Internet during extraction of a CD.

    • You are connected to the Internet, but the online database is missing album art (or there is no media information at all) for the CD you are ripping.

    • Your system administrator has prevented your computer to download items such as album art from the Internet.

    • You ripped the CD using one program other than Windows Media Player; doing so could prevent the player from a match in the database online.

    Finally, if the online database contains album art wrong for a CD, the Player downloads this pouch.

    You can't start over with the new library in Windows media player, but you can delete the database of Windows Media Player. To do this, follow these steps:

    (a) output Windows Media Player.

    (b) click Start, run, type %LOCALAPPDATA%\Microsoft\Media Player, and then click OK.

    (c), select all the files in the folder and then click on Delete on the file menu.

    Note: you don't have to remove the folders that are in this folder.

    (d) restart Windows Media Player.

    Note Windows Media Player automatically rebuilds the database.

    If the above does not solve your problem then clear cache of database of Windows Media Player files. To do this, follow these steps:

    (a) output Windows Media Player.

    (b) click Start, click Run, type % LOCALAPPDATA%\Microsoft, and then click OK.

    (c) select the folder Media Player and then click on Delete on the file menu.

    (d) restart Windows Media Player.

    To avoid duplicate entries or not valid to be added to the library when you play music, you can see in this section:

    a. When you move digital media files on your computer, the file name and path of file information remain unchanged in your library. Then when you select a file to play to its new location, a new entry is created in your library if you select the option automatically added to your library when played. As a result, your library can quickly contain a large number of entries, duplicate or invalid.

    b. to prevent it be automatically added to your library of music files

    (c) in Windows Media Player, on the Tools menu, click Options.

    d. on the Player tab, clear the files of music to add to the library when played check box.
